Proprietary trading, or prop trading, is a charming avenue for individuals seeking to dive into the financial markets. Unlike traditional trading where investors use their own funds, prop trading includes trading with a firm’s capital. For rookies looking to venture into this dynamic discipline, understanding its nuances and adopting efficient strategies is crucial. Here, we delve into essential suggestions to assist learners navigate the world of prop trading successfully.

5. Utilize Risk Management Strategies
Efficient risk management is essential for long-term success in prop trading. Implement risk management strategies corresponding to position sizing, stop-loss orders, and diversification to mitigate potential losses. By no means risk more than a predetermined share of your trading capital on any single trade. Adhere to strict risk-reward ratios to make sure that potential profits outweigh potential losses.
